61.7% of the people in Walden are religious:
- 25.3% are Baptist
- 1.9% are Episcopalian
- 4.0% are Catholic
- 0.6% are Lutheran
- 7.8% are Methodist
- 4.8% are Pentecostal
- 4.1% are Presbyterian
- 0.7%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 11.5% are another Christian faith
- 0.4%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.7% affilitates with Islam
